The electric vehicle industry is evolving at a very fast pace, and software has now become just as important as mechanical engineering. Modern electric vehicles are no longer simple transport machines; instead, they are intelligent digital systems powered by advanced computing and artificial intelligence. Features such as navigation, safety control, energy optimization, and entertainment are all managed through software, making Software and AI in EVs a core part of the automotive revolution. This shift is transforming how people experience driving by making vehicles smarter, safer, and more connected.
The integration of Software and AI in EVs is introducing powerful innovations such as over-the-air updates, advanced driver assistance systems, mobile applications, and cybersecurity frameworks. These technologies are not only improving performance but also enhancing user convenience and safety at the same time. As global automakers compete to build smarter electric vehicles, software is becoming the main foundation of innovation. This article explains how EV software works through OTA updates, ADAS systems, apps, and security features in detail.
The Rise of Software-Defined Electric Vehicles
Electric vehicles are no longer defined only by batteries, motors, and physical components. Instead, they are becoming software-defined machines where most vehicle functions are controlled digitally. Software and AI in EVs allow manufacturers to continuously improve performance, safety, and user experience even after the vehicle has been purchased. This makes EVs highly flexible and future-ready compared to traditional vehicles.
This transformation is reshaping the entire automotive industry. Vehicles are now updated in a similar way to smartphones, where new features and improvements are delivered through software updates rather than physical changes. This reduces dependency on hardware upgrades and allows manufacturers to innovate faster. As a result, EVs are becoming more intelligent, adaptable, and long-lasting in performance.
Over-the-Air (OTA) Updates in EVs
Over-the-air (OTA) updates are one of the most powerful features in Software and AI in EVs. These updates allow manufacturers to send new software directly to vehicles without requiring drivers to visit service centers. OTA updates can include bug fixes, performance improvements, security patches, and even completely new features that enhance driving experience.
OTA technology ensures that electric vehicles remain updated throughout their entire lifecycle. It also reduces maintenance costs and downtime for users while improving convenience. Many leading EV manufacturers now rely on OTA updates as a standard feature, allowing continuous improvement of vehicles after purchase. This makes EV ownership more dynamic and future-oriented.
How OTA Updates Improve Performance
OTA updates do more than just fix software issues; they actively improve vehicle performance over time. Software and AI in EVs enable real-time optimization of battery efficiency, energy consumption, and driving range through intelligent updates. This means a vehicle can become more efficient without any physical modifications.
In some cases, manufacturers have used OTA updates to enhance acceleration, extend battery range, and improve driving modes. These upgrades demonstrate how software can redefine vehicle capabilities after sale. It highlights the growing importance of digital systems in shaping the long-term value of electric vehicles.
ADAS: Advanced Driver Assistance Systems
Advanced Driver Assistance Systems (ADAS) are a major innovation in Software and AI in EVs. These systems use sensors, cameras, radar, and AI algorithms to assist drivers in real time. Features like lane keeping assist, adaptive cruise control, collision warning, and automatic braking are all part of ADAS technology.
The primary goal of ADAS is to reduce human error and improve road safety. While fully autonomous driving is still under development, ADAS already provides significant safety support to drivers. It helps reduce accidents, improve awareness, and make driving more comfortable in different road conditions.
The Role of AI in Driving Assistance
Artificial intelligence is the core technology behind ADAS in Software and AI in EVs. AI systems analyze data from multiple sensors to understand road conditions, traffic flow, and potential hazards. This allows vehicles to respond quickly and make real-time decisions.
AI can detect obstacles, maintain safe distance from other vehicles, and adjust speed automatically when necessary. These capabilities significantly enhance driving safety and reduce reaction time compared to human drivers. As AI continues to improve, driving assistance systems are becoming more accurate and reliable.
EV Apps and Digital Ecosystems
Mobile applications are an essential part of Software and AI in EVs, allowing users to connect with their vehicles digitally. These apps provide remote access to vehicle functions such as locking, unlocking, battery monitoring, and climate control. They also help users locate charging stations and plan trips efficiently.
EV apps create a complete digital ecosystem where drivers can interact with their vehicles anytime and anywhere. This improves convenience and gives users more control over their driving experience. As connectivity improves, these apps are becoming central to EV ownership.
Smart Features in EV Apps
Modern EV apps offer a wide range of smart features powered by Software and AI in EVs. These include remote diagnostics, charging scheduling, real-time alerts, and navigation integration. Users can also monitor battery health and driving performance directly from their smartphones.
Some apps also provide detailed analytics about driving behavior, helping users improve efficiency and reduce energy consumption. These features make electric vehicles more interactive and intelligent, enhancing the overall ownership experience.
Cybersecurity in Electric Vehicles
Cybersecurity is a critical component of Software and AI in EVs due to increasing vehicle connectivity. Modern EVs rely heavily on internet-based systems, making them potential targets for cyberattacks. Protecting these systems is essential for ensuring safe and reliable operation.
Manufacturers use encryption, firewalls, and secure communication protocols to protect vehicles from unauthorized access. Regular software updates also help fix security vulnerabilities. Cybersecurity ensures that both user data and vehicle systems remain safe from digital threats.
Protecting Data and Vehicle Systems
Electric vehicles collect large amounts of sensitive data, including location history, driving behavior, and user preferences. In Software and AI in EVs, protecting this data is a top priority for manufacturers and developers.
Advanced monitoring systems are used to detect suspicious activity and prevent data breaches. Continuous updates and security patches help strengthen protection over time. This ensures that users can trust their connected vehicles without worrying about privacy risks.
AI-Powered Energy Management
Energy optimization is one of the most important advantages of Software and AI in EVs. AI systems analyze driving patterns, traffic conditions, and road terrain to optimize battery usage. This helps improve energy efficiency and extend driving range.
Smart energy management also helps reduce charging frequency and increase battery lifespan. By intelligently distributing power usage, AI ensures that vehicles operate at maximum efficiency under different conditions. This is a key factor in improving EV performance.
Predictive Maintenance in EVs
Predictive maintenance is an advanced feature enabled by Software and AI in EVs that helps identify potential vehicle issues before they occur. Sensors continuously monitor vehicle health and performance to detect early warning signs.
This approach reduces repair costs and prevents unexpected breakdowns. Drivers receive alerts when maintenance is needed, allowing timely servicing. Predictive systems improve reliability and extend the life of electric vehicles.
The Future of Autonomous Driving
Autonomous driving is one of the most advanced applications of Software and AI in EVs. While fully self-driving vehicles are still in development, significant progress has been made in partial automation. AI systems can already handle tasks like steering, braking, and parking in controlled environments.
The future of autonomous driving promises safer roads and reduced human error. As technology advances, vehicles will become more independent and capable of handling complex driving situations. This will redefine transportation as we know it today.
Challenges in Software-Driven EVs
Despite rapid progress, Software and AI in EVs face several challenges including cybersecurity risks, high development costs, and regulatory issues. Ensuring safety and reliability in all conditions remains a major concern for manufacturers.
Another challenge is maintaining system stability across different environments and software updates. Continuous testing and improvement are required to ensure consistent performance. These challenges highlight the complexity of building fully software-driven vehicles.
Read More: MyRepublic Launches Email Guard Powered by Check Point for SMEs
The Future of EV Software Innovation
The future of Software and AI in EVs is expected to be highly connected and intelligent, with vehicles communicating in real time with infrastructure and other systems. This will improve traffic management and road safety significantly.
EVs will also integrate more deeply with smart city technologies, enabling efficient transportation networks. Software will continue to drive innovation, making electric vehicles more advanced, autonomous, and environmentally friendly.
FAQs (Frequently Asked Questions)
What is software and AI in EVs?
It refers to advanced digital systems and artificial intelligence that manage, control, and continuously improve electric vehicle performance, safety, and smart features.
What are OTA updates in EVs?
OTA (Over-the-Air) updates allow electric vehicles to receive software upgrades, new features, and bug fixes remotely without visiting a service center.
What is ADAS in electric vehicles?
ADAS (Advanced Driver Assistance Systems) includes smart safety features like lane keeping, adaptive cruise control, and automatic emergency braking to support drivers.
How do EV apps work?
EV apps connect users to their vehicles through smartphones, allowing remote control, battery monitoring, charging management, and real-time vehicle tracking.
Why is cybersecurity important in EVs?
Cybersecurity protects electric vehicles from hacking attempts, data theft, and unauthorized access, ensuring safe and secure digital driving systems.
Can AI improve EV performance?
Yes, AI improves EV performance by optimizing battery usage, enhancing driving efficiency, predicting maintenance needs, and improving overall vehicle safety.
Are EVs becoming fully autonomous?
EVs are moving toward autonomy, but fully self-driving technology is still under development, with current systems offering partial automation features.
What is the future of EV software?
The future of EV software includes fully connected vehicles, smart city integration, real-time communication systems, and highly advanced autonomous driving technology.
Conclusion:
Software and AI in EVs are transforming the automotive industry by making vehicles smarter, safer, and more efficient. From OTA updates to ADAS systems and cybersecurity, software is now the foundation of modern electric mobility.
As technology continues to evolve, EVs will become even more intelligent and connected. The future of transportation will rely heavily on software-driven innovation, shaping a new era of smart and sustainable mobility.
